I have, in mini form at least, and I like it pretty well. Generally I do prefer liquid or gel blushes to powders (particularly if I’m using a liquid foundation, I feel like they give me that “dewey glow”). Tarte’s gel is pretty thick, which gives you time to blend it, which is nice, but I feel like I also have to work it around and in quite a lot to make sure I don’t have any splotchyness.
Blush-wise I’ve become a quick, if guilty (because of the price), devotee of Benefit’s newish Posientint, I love love love the natural-looking flush it gives my pale skin.

About Tarte Cheek stains – They are great!!! but my recommendation is that if you are going to use them – purchase the mini version because they work much easier – They twist up unlike the normal version which is pushed up from the bottom and can sometimes get messy because you have to push them back down manually which is a pain and can ruin the product…
